'Innocence' is a haunting new film set in a sinister girls school situated in a dark and foreboding forest.
It's the kind of place that throws up all manner of questions, such as why new pupils arrive in coffins, where the mysterious subterranean tunnels lead to and what exactly goes on in the main building?
Directed by Lucile Hadzihalolovic, 'Innocence' opens on September 30.
